Morel conducted the Guilford All-County Honors orchestra in 2018, as well as opera and musical theater productions for High Point University and Texas Women's …Kwamé Ryan was hired Tuesday as music director of the Charlotte Symphony Orchestra in North Carolina and given a four-year contract to start with the 2024-25 season. The 53-year-old succeeds Christopher Warren-Green, who stepped down after the 2021-22 season, his 12th as music director. William Grant Still (1895-1978), often called The Dean of African American Composers, was an American composer, arranger, conductor, and pioneer of early 20th-century classical music. He was born in Mississippi and grew up in Little Rock Arkansas where he learned to play the violin and piano. Tryon Street, Suite 350 Charlotte, NC 28202 PATRON SERVICES HOURS Monday-Friday | 9 am-5 pm CONTACT US The Charlotte Symphony Youth Orchestra traveled to New York City June 15 through 19, 2017. The highlight of the trip was their performance at Carnegie Hall on June 17.
